P0015 on 2007-2015 Lexus RX350: Exhaust Camshaft Timing Causes & Fixes

For the 2007-2015 Lexus RX350, code P0015 is most often caused by a faulty Bank 1 exhaust Oil Control Valve (OCV), also called a VVT solenoid. After verifying the engine oil is clean and full, this is the primary suspect. Expect to pay $50-$100 for an aftermarket OCV and $150-$250 for an OEM part; it's a DIY-possible job, but access is difficult. The code is frequently accompanied by VSC and AWD warning lights.

⚠️ Drivable, but... — You can drive the vehicle, but you may experience a rough idle, poor acceleration, and reduced fuel economy. Ignoring the issue for too long could lead to more significant engine problems, so it's best to diagnose and repair it promptly. Many owners report no noticeable performance issues other than the warning lights.
Key Takeaways
  • First, check your engine oil. Low or dirty oil is a common cause and the easiest thing to fix.
  • P0015 specifically points to the exhaust camshaft on the rear cylinder bank (Bank 1), which is difficult to access.
  • The most likely failed part is the Oil Control Valve (OCV), also known as a VVT solenoid.
  • A cost-effective diagnostic step is to swap the suspected rear OCV with the identical front one (Bank 2) and see if the code follows (changing to P0025).
  • Due to the difficult access, replacing the Bank 1 OCV is a challenging DIY job that may be best left to a professional if you are not experienced.
The trouble code P0015 stands for '"B" Camshaft Position - Timing Over-Retarded (Bank 1)'. On the 2GR-FE engine in your Lexus, this means the Engine Control Module (ECM) has detected that the exhaust camshaft on Bank 1 is not in the position it's supposed to be. Specifically, its timing is lagging or 'retarded' compared to the ECM's command. Bank 1 is the cylinder bank closer to the firewall (the rear bank), and 'B' refers to the exhaust camshaft.

What's Unique About the 2007-2015 Lexus RX350

The 2GR-FE 3.5L V6 engine inside a Lexus RX350 engine bay.
The Lexus RX350's transverse engine layout places Bank 1 against the firewall, making the exhaust OCV significantly harder to reach than Bank 2.

The 2GR-FE engine is widely used across Toyota and Lexus and is known for its reliability, but its VVT-i (Variable Valve Timing with intelligence) system is highly dependent on clean engine oil and proper oil pressure. The most significant platform-specific challenge for this code on the RX350 is the location of the Bank 1 components. Because the engine is mounted transversely, Bank 1 is pressed against the firewall, making the exhaust OCV and its filter extremely difficult to access compared to the easily reachable Bank 2 components at the front of the vehicle. Many owners report this code appearing after a long highway trip.

Generation note: This range covers two generations of the RX350: the second generation (2007-2009) and the third generation (2010-2015). Both use the 2GR-FE 3.5L V6 engine, and the causes, symptoms, and diagnostic procedures for P0015 are virtually identical between them. Part numbers for the OCV may differ slightly, so always verify by VIN. The earlier 2007-2009 models were also part of a service campaign for a rubber VVT-i oil line that could rupture, a separate but related VVT system issue.

Symptoms You May Notice

  • Check Engine Light is on
  • Traction control (VSC) and/or AWD warning lights may also illuminate
  • Rough or unstable idle
  • Hesitation or stumbling on acceleration
  • Reduced engine power
  • Decreased fuel economy
  • Difficulty starting
⚠️ Don't Waste Money on the Wrong Fix
  • Replacing the camshaft position sensor. The sensor is usually not the cause for a P0015 code; it is simply reporting the timing deviation that is caused by another component like the OCV or low oil pressure. The code indicates a performance problem, not a sensor circuit failure.

Most Likely Causes

A side-by-side comparison of a clean, new oil control valve versus one heavily contaminated with engine oil sludge.
Comparison: A clean OCV (left) versus a solenoid clogged with oil sludge (right), which prevents proper timing adjustment and triggers the P0015 code.
  1. Low or Dirty Engine Oil 🔴 High Probability The VVT-i system uses oil pressure to actuate the camshaft phasers. Insufficient or contaminated oil can't operate the system correctly, leading to timing deviations. Sludge can clog the small passages in the OCVs and their filters.
    How to confirm: Check the oil level on the dipstick and inspect the oil's color and consistency. If the level is low or the oil is dark, gritty, or sludgy, this is your first step.     Typical fix: Top up the oil to the correct level or perform a complete oil and filter change using the manufacturer-recommended oil viscosity (typically 5W-30 or 0W-20 depending on the model year, check your owner's manual).
    Est. part cost: $40-$80
  2. Faulty Bank 1 Exhaust Oil Control Valve (OCV) / VVT Solenoid 🔴 High Probability These solenoids are a common failure point. They can get clogged with debris from the oil or fail electrically, causing them to stick, especially when hot.
    How to confirm: You can test the solenoid's resistance with a multimeter (should be 6.9-7.9 ohms at 68°F). The most definitive DIY test is to swap the suspect Bank 1 exhaust OCV with the easily accessible Bank 2 exhaust OCV (at the front of the engine). If the code changes to P0025 (Bank 2), you've confirmed the OCV is bad.
    Typical fix: Replace the Bank 1 exhaust Oil Control Valve. Due to its location at the rear of the engine, this is a labor-intensive job often quoted at over $1000 by dealers.     Est. part cost: $50-$250
  3. Clogged Oil Control Valve Filter Screen 🟡 Medium Probability A small mesh filter protects each OCV from debris. If oil changes are neglected, this screen can become clogged with sludge, restricting oil flow to the solenoid and cam phaser.
    How to confirm: The filter is located in the oil passage leading to the OCV. It must be visually inspected for blockage. On the 2GR-FE, these filters are often located under a banjo bolt near the OCV housing and can be removed for cleaning or replacement.
    Typical fix: Remove and clean the filter screen. If it's damaged or cannot be cleaned, it should be replaced. This is often done at the same time as an OCV replacement.
    Est. part cost: $5-$20

Rare But Worth Checking

  • Stretched Timing Chain: While the 2GR-FE uses a durable timing chain, on very high-mileage engines (well over 200,000 miles) it can stretch, causing timing to be consistently retarded. This is a much more involved and expensive repair.
  • Failed VVT-i Cam Gear (Phaser): The actuator on the end of the camshaft can fail internally, getting stuck in one position. This usually requires replacement of the cam gear itself, which is a significant job. Toyota issued TSB T-SB-0094-09 for some 2GR-FE engines for a ticking noise that could be related to this component.
  • Faulty Engine Control Module (ECM): This is extremely rare. The ECM should only be considered as the cause after all other possibilities have been exhaustively ruled out by a professional.

Diagnosis Steps

A digital multimeter measuring the resistance of an oil control valve solenoid.
Testing the OCV resistance with a multimeter is a key diagnostic step; a healthy solenoid should read between 6.9 and 7.9 ohms.
  1. Verify engine oil level and condition. Top up or change oil if necessary. This is the first and most important step.
  2. Scan for any other trouble codes to see if there are related electrical circuit codes (like P0013).
  3. Using a capable scan tool like Toyota Techstream, observe the live data for commanded vs. actual camshaft angle for Bank 1 Exhaust. A significant and persistent lag confirms the issue. Some scan tools also allow for active control of the OCV to see if the timing angle changes.
  4. Inspect the Bank 1 exhaust OCV connector and wiring for any visible damage.
  5. Test the OCV. You can apply 12V power to see if it clicks, or measure its internal resistance (approx. 7-8 ohms). For a more thorough test, energize the solenoid for a minute and check if the resistance increases significantly, indicating an internal fault when hot.
  6. For a definitive diagnosis, swap the Bank 1 exhaust OCV with the Bank 2 exhaust OCV. Clear the codes and drive the vehicle. If the code returns as P0025 (Bank 2), the OCV is faulty and needs replacement.
  7. If the OCV is not the issue, inspect the OCV filter screen for blockage. This may require removing a banjo bolt or a dedicated plug near the OCV.
  8. If all of the above check out, the issue may be more severe, such as a stretched timing chain or a faulty cam phaser, which requires more advanced mechanical inspection.

Related Codes That Often Appear With This One

  • P0013 — P0013 is for the '"B" Camshaft Position Actuator Circuit (Bank 1)'. It indicates an electrical problem (open or short) in the OCV circuit, while P0015 indicates a mechanical/performance issue (timing is wrong). They can appear together if the OCV has failed electrically.
  • P0014 — P0014 is for '"B" Camshaft Position - Timing Over-Advanced (Bank 1)'. It's the opposite of P0015 but points to the same system (Bank 1 exhaust VVT). Seeing both or alternating between them could indicate an erratic OCV or oil flow issue.
  • P0012 — P0012 is for '"A" Camshaft Position - Timing Over-Retarded (Bank 1)', which refers to the intake camshaft on the same bank. Seeing both P0012 and P0015 could point to a more systemic issue on Bank 1, like a clogged oil passage feeding both VVT actuators.

Technical Service Bulletins (TSBs) & Recalls

  • T-SB-0094-09: Addresses a ticking noise and/or MIL ON with VVT codes (including P0015) for some 2GR-FE engines, pointing towards potential inspection of the VVT-i gear actuator.

Platform-Specific Known Issues

  • The primary issue is the difficult access to the Bank 1 (rear) exhaust OCV, which is located on the firewall side of the engine under the intake plenum and other components.
  • Early 2GR-FE engines (2007-2009 models) were subject to Limited Service Campaign (LSC) 9LH for a rubber VVT-i oil line that could rupture, causing catastrophic oil loss. This was later updated to an all-metal line. While this failure causes more severe symptoms than just a P0015 code, it is a critical VVT system issue on this engine family.

Mechanic-Grade Diagnostic Values

  • VVT Oil Control Valve (OCV) Solenoid Resistance — expected: 6.9 to 7.9 Ohms at 68°F (20°C).. Failure: Resistance is outside the specified range, or resistance climbs significantly when the solenoid is energized and heats up, indicating a failing coil winding.
  • VVT Oil Control Valve (OCV) Solenoid Current Draw — expected: Approximately 1.47 Amps at 12V.. Failure: Current draw drops as the solenoid heats up (indicating rising resistance), which is a sign of an internal fault.

Scan Tool Commands That Help

  • Toyota Techstream: Active Test: Control the VVT Exhaust Linear (Bank 1) — This command allows the technician to manually operate the Bank 1 exhaust OCV. While monitoring engine speed, activating the solenoid should cause a noticeable change (e.g., rough idle or stall). If there's no change, it points to a problem with the OCV, its filter, or the cam phaser.
  • Toyota Techstream: Utility: All Readiness — After a repair, this function can be used to check the status of the VVT system monitor to confirm if the fault has been successfully rectified without having to complete a full, lengthy drive cycle.

Wiring & Ground Locations

  • E7 (Connector) — On the Engine Control Module (ECM). The ECM location can vary; on earlier models it may be in the glovebox area, while later models have it in the engine bay.. This connector contains the pins for the Bank 1 Exhaust OCV. Specifically, pin E7-9 (OE1+) and E7-10 (OE1-) are the positive and negative terminals for the Bank 1 Exhaust Oil Control Valve. These are the pins to test for voltage and continuity when diagnosing a circuit fault (like P0013) alongside P0015.
  • E01, E02, E03, E04 (Grounds) — These are the main ECM ground points. Their physical location is on the engine block/cylinder head.. A poor ECM ground can cause a wide range of erratic issues, including incorrect sensor readings and faulty actuator control. While not a common cause for an isolated P0015, verifying these grounds are clean and tight is a crucial step in advanced electrical diagnosis after checking the specific component circuit.

Real Owner Repair Stories

  • YouTube channel 'Pine Hollow Auto Diagnostics' (Lexus with 2GR-FE engine (specific model not stated, but engine is the same)) — Intermittent P0015 code that has been occurring for years.
    ❌ Tried (didn't work) The owner had been living with the intermittent code for a long time.
    ✅ What actually fixed it The technician diagnosed a faulty Bank 1 exhaust OCV. The definitive test was energizing the solenoid for one minute and observing its resistance climb from a normal 8.3 ohms to nearly 10 ohms as it heated up, while other solenoids remained stable. This confirmed an internal winding failure that only occurred when hot, explaining the intermittent nature of the fault.
  • ClubLexus Forum user 'andbel' (2013 RX 350) — Check Engine light, VSC light, and code P0015.
    ❌ Tried (didn't work) Owner almost scheduled a shop appointment assuming a complex repair was needed.
    ✅ What actually fixed it The owner checked the engine oil and found it was on the lower end of the dipstick. After topping off the oil and changing the engine air filter, the warning lights and the code cleared.

Model Year Variations Within This Range

  • 2007-2009: These early models were equipped with a VVT-i oil line that contained a rubber section, which was a known failure point leading to oil leaks. Models from 2010 onward came from the factory with an improved all-metal line.
  • Early vs. Late Production: The location of the Engine Control Unit (ECU) was moved over the production life of the 2GR-FE. Early models often had the ECU located inside the cabin (e.g., glovebox area), while later versions had the ECU moved into the engine bay. This is relevant for any advanced electrical diagnosis.

Other Known Issues on This Vehicle

Issues unrelated to this code that are worth knowing about as an owner of this generation:

  • Rupturing VVT-i Oil Line 🔴 High — Common on 2007-2009 models with the original rubber/metal hybrid oil line. Less common on later models which received an all-metal line from the factory. (Ref: Lexus LSC 9LH (Limited Service Campaign) extended the warranty for replacement.)
  • Melting or Cracked Dashboard 🟡 Low — Extremely common on 2007-2009 models, especially in hot, humid climates. The dashboard surface becomes sticky, shiny, and may crack. (Ref: Lexus Warranty Enhancement Programs (ZLD, ZLZ, ZE6) were issued to cover replacement, though many have expired.)
  • Power Steering Rack Leak 🟠 Medium — Commonly reported on 2007-2009 models. Leaks typically originate from the passenger side of the steering rack assembly. (Ref: L-SB-0016-14 and L-SB-0107-12 were issued to provide an overhaul procedure or replacement for leaking racks.)
  • Timing Cover Oil Leak 🟠 Medium — Can occur on higher-mileage 2GR-FE engines. The sealant on the front timing cover degrades, causing a persistent oil seep or leak. Repair is labor-intensive.
  • Water Pump Failure 🟠 Medium — Considered a wear item, but some earlier 2GR-FE engines experienced premature water pump failures. Failure can lead to coolant loss and overheating.

Used vs. New Parts: Buying Guide for This Vehicle

When a used part is the smart pick: For this repair, using used parts is generally not recommended. The primary failure parts (OCV solenoid, filters) are relatively inexpensive new, and the labor to access the Bank 1 components is significant. Using a used OCV is a gamble that could lead to repeating the difficult repair. A complete used engine from a low-mileage JDM source can be a viable option if the original engine has suffered catastrophic failure.

Donor-vehicle mileage cap: roughly under 60000 miles for the part to have meaningful remaining life.

What to inspect on the donor part:

  • For a complete JDM engine, look for sellers who provide compression test numbers.
  • Inspect for external signs of oil leaks, particularly around the timing cover and valve covers.
  • If possible, inspect inside the oil fill cap for signs of heavy sludge, which indicates poor maintenance.

OEM-only on this vehicle (don't cheap out):

  • VVT-i Cam Gear (Phaser): Aftermarket phasers have a poor reputation for reliability. If this part needs replacement, OEM is the safest choice to ensure longevity.
  • Engine Control Module (ECM): Due to programming and security requirements, a new or professionally refurbished and programmed OEM unit is necessary if the ECM is confirmed faulty.

Aftermarket brands forum-validated for this vehicle:

  • Denso: Denso is the original equipment manufacturer (OEM) for the VVT solenoids. Buying a Denso-branded part is equivalent to getting the dealer part without the Lexus/Toyota box.
  • Aisin: Aisin is another major OEM supplier for Toyota and is a trusted brand for engine components like oil pumps and water pumps, and their solenoids are also considered high quality.

Brands owners have reported issues with on this vehicle:

  • Generic/No-Name eBay/Amazon parts: While tempting due to low cost, unbranded electronic components like VVT solenoids have a very high failure rate. Given the labor cost to replace the Bank 1 solenoid, using a cheap part is a significant risk.

Frequently Asked Questions

Why is the repair for P0015 on my RX350 so expensive? I was quoted over $1000.
The high cost is typically due to the difficult location of the Bank 1 exhaust Oil Control Valve (OCV), a common cause for P0015. It is located on the rear of the engine, against the firewall and under the intake plenum, making it a very labor-intensive job for which dealers often quote over $1000.
I have a 2008 RX350. Is there a known VVT-i oil line issue I should be aware of?
Yes, 2007-2009 models with the 2GR-FE engine were subject to Limited Service Campaign (LSC) 9LH for a rubber VVT-i oil line that could rupture, leading to catastrophic oil loss. This was later updated to an all-metal line. While a rupture causes more severe symptoms than just a P0015 code, it is a critical VVT system issue on these earlier models.
How can I be sure the Bank 1 exhaust OCV is bad before attempting the difficult replacement?
The most definitive DIY diagnostic test is to swap the suspect Bank 1 exhaust OCV with the easily accessible Bank 2 exhaust OCV at the front of the engine. After clearing the codes and driving, if the trouble code changes to P0025 (the Bank 2 equivalent), you have confirmed the OCV is faulty.
My Check Engine Light just came on with code P0015. What is the absolute first thing I should check?
The first and most important step is to check your engine oil level and condition. Low or dirty engine oil is a high-probability cause for P0015 on the 2GR-FE engine, as the VVT-i system relies on oil pressure to function correctly. A low oil level alone has been reported by owners to trigger this code.
Does TSB T-SB-0094-09 apply to the P0015 code on my RX350?
Yes, Technical Service Bulletin T-SB-0094-09 addresses a ticking noise and/or a Check Engine Light with VVT codes, including P0015, for some 2GR-FE engines. It points towards a potential inspection of the VVT-i gear actuator if more common causes are ruled out.
I replaced the OCV but still have the P0015 code. What else could be clogged?
You should inspect the small mesh filter screen that protects the Oil Control Valve. If oil changes have been neglected, this screen can become clogged with sludge, restricting oil flow to the VVT system even if the OCV itself is new. It is located in the oil passage leading to the valve.
